Replace beego/orm with dbx (#2693)

* Start migration to dbx package

* Fix annotations and bookmarks bindings

* Fix tests

* Fix more tests

* Remove remaining references to beego/orm

* Add PostScanner/PostMapper interfaces

* Fix importing SmartPlaylists

* Renaming

* More renaming

* Fix artist DB mapping

* Fix playlist updates

* Remove bookmarks at the end of the test

* Remove remaining `orm` struct tags

* Fix user timestamps DB access

* Fix smart playlist evaluated_at DB access

* Fix search3
